Some high level boss have really mean mechanics again evasion based character, some do.

Facetanking buils now .... => vaal pact ( well there is vinktar too ... )
And vaal pact is on the evasion side.

Plus, now either hybrid or full ES seems to be the way to go in endgame, life pool being often not enough ( well having 4k ES on top of it makes a much bigger buffer ) ... and that synergies more with evasion than armor.

I think it's just not true to pretend that armor characters have sustain and evasion characters don't.,
There is a bit more life regeneration on the left side of the tree, but life regen alone isn't enough against hard hitting bosses anyway.
Vaal pact is how you get sustain against a boss, and it's not on the left side of the tree.
